Yes read, write and execute permission is needed, so you have to use an install directory capable of these for the user.

You could use my tooling library, which takes care of it for each platform, take a look at #2

@DatL4g I'm using your Tooling library. The only difference I see with the example on the ticket are the jvmArgs in the build.gradle file. I was using this:

jvmArgs("--add-opens", "java.desktop/sun.awt=ALL-UNNAMED")
jvmArgs("--add-opens", "java.desktop/java.awt.peer=ALL-UNNAMED")

if (System.getProperty("os.name").contains("Mac")) {
     jvmArgs("--add-opens", "java.desktop/sun.lwawt=ALL-UNNAMED")
     jvmArgs("--add-opens", "java.desktop/sun.lwawt.macosx=ALL-UNNAMED")
}

instead of this:

jvmArgs("--add-opens", "java.base/java.lang=ALL-UNNAMED")
jvmArgs("--add-opens", "java.desktop/sun.awt=ALL-UNNAMED")
jvmArgs("--add-opens", "java.desktop/sun.java2d=ALL-UNNAMED")
jvmArgs("--add-opens", "java.desktop/java.awt.peer=ALL-UNNAMED")

if (System.getProperty("os.name").contains("Mac")) {
     jvmArgs("--add-opens", "java.desktop/sun.lwawt=ALL-UNNAMED")
     jvmArgs("--add-opens", "java.desktop/sun.lwawt.macosx=ALL-UNNAMED")
}

Could that be the cause of the issue on Windows?
